Transaction 957515a3838e291796c77141c21f732630f7e2faeac75c99a3b4c70578dc316d
1 Input
1 Output
-
957515a3838e291796c77141c21f732630f7e2faeac75c99a3b4c70578dc316d:0
- value
- 51571
- script pubkey
- OP_0 OP_PUSHBYTES_20 9cf83fc91f4b5a878c11fbe194a3ae2e067bc2ce
- address
- bc1qnnurljglfddg0rq3l0sefgaw9cr8hskweyq4r5